What is Check Point Email & Collaboration Protection?
Check Point Email & Collaboration Protection is a cloud-based security platform that protects your email, SharePoint, OneDrive, Microsoft Teams, and Google Drive using advanced threat intelligence, machine learning, and real-time behavioral analysis. It's powered by Check Point's ThreatCloud — the world's largest cyber threat intelligence network.

How It Works
Check Point connects directly to your Microsoft 365 or Google Workspace environment via API, scanning all email and collaboration content in real-time:
- Email and files arrive in your environment
- AI-powered analysis checks for threats across multiple vectors
- Clean content is delivered normally
- Threats are quarantined and you're notified
Managing Quarantined Email
When Check Point blocks a suspicious email, it's placed in quarantine rather than deleted. You receive notifications showing quarantined messages, allowing you to:
- Release legitimate emails that were incorrectly flagged
- Block senders to prevent future messages
- Allowlist trusted senders
- Report false positives to improve filtering

Quick Answers
Why am I not receiving emails I'm expecting?
Check your spam/junk folder first. If not there, the email may have been quarantined by Check Point. You can access the quarantine portal to review and release legitimate emails. Contact support if you need help accessing the portal or allowlisting a sender.
How do I send an encrypted email?
Add [SECURE] to your email subject line to trigger automatic encryption. The recipient will receive a link to access the secure message. This is required when sending sensitive information like financial data or personal information outside your organization.
